Re: Mesozoic Dinosauria Genus & Species List 2008
Thanks Daniel, I've incorporated all the changes.
I'll also provisionally include _Nedoceratops_ Ukrainsky, 2007 as a valid
genus, as a replacement name for the preoccupied _Diceratops_ Lull, 1905. I'm
surprised that Ukrainsky didn't rename _Microceratops_ Bohlin, 1953 as well.
Duriavenator_ Benson, 2008 is the valid name of the genus that has
_Megalosaurus hesperis_ as its type species. "Walkersaurus" (previously
proposed as a new genus for _M. hesperis_) is a nomen nudum. More on this
later, because the author of "Walkersaurus" continues to press his case that
his name is valid, and has seniority over _Duriavenator_. (It doesn't, because
"Walkersaurus" was never a valid genus.)
